Race in Winfield
The most populous races in Winfield are White / Caucasian (4,507 | 93.3%), Black / African American (223 | 4.6%), and Asian (65 | 1.3%).
Race | # Population | % Population |
Asian | 65 | 1.3% |
Black / African American | 223 | 4.6% |
Hawaiian / Pacific | 0 | 0.0% |
Hispanic or Latino | 29 | 0.6% |
Native / Alaskan | 0 | 0.0% |
White / Caucasian | 4,507 | 93.3% |
Two or more Races | 37 | 0.8% |
Some other Race | 0 | 0.0% |
Total | 4,832 | 100.0% |

Employment Characteristics in Winfield
Employment by Class of Employer in Winfield
Among the 2,149 employed individuals in Winfield, private company employees (1,464 | 68.1%), not-for-profit organizations (237 | 11.0%), and local government employees (156 | 7.3%) make up the most common classes of employment.
Employer Class | # Employees | % Employees |
Private Company Employees | 1,464 | 68.1% |
Self-Employed (Incorporated) | 53 | 2.5% |
Self-Employed (Not Incorporated) | 10 | 0.5% |
Not-for-profit Organizations | 237 | 11.0% |
Local Government Employees | 156 | 7.3% |
State Government Employees | 152 | 7.1% |
Federal Government Employees | 77 | 3.6% |
Unpaid Family Workers | 0 | 0.0% |
Total | 2,149 | 100.0% |

Employment Industries by Sex in Winfield
Employment Industries in Winfield
The major employment industries in Winfield include Health Care & Social Assistance (509 | 22.7%), Manufacturing (342 | 15.2%), Educational Services (195 | 8.7%), Real Estate, Rental & Leasing (143 | 6.4%), and Accommodation & Food Services (130 | 5.8%).
Employment Industries by Sex in Winfield
The Winfield industries that see more men than women are Mining, Quarrying, & Extraction (100.0%), Information (100.0%), and Utilities (92.1%), whereas the industries that tend to have a higher number of women are Finance & Insurance (100.0%), Administrative & Support (100.0%), and Health Care & Social Assistance (92.5%).
Industry | Male | Female |
Agriculture, Fishing & Hunting |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Mining, Quarrying, & Extraction | 37 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Construction | 68 (60.7%) | 44 (39.3%) |
Manufacturing | 299 (87.4%) | 43 (12.6%) |
Wholesale Trade | 77 (72.6%) | 29 (27.4%) |
Retail Trade | 41 (34.2%) | 79 (65.8%) |
Transportation & Warehousing | 94 (81.0%) | 22 (19.0%) |
Utilities | 105 (92.1%) | 9 (7.9%) |
Information | 10 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Finance & Insurance | 0 (0.0%) | 67 (100.0%) |
Real Estate, Rental & Leasing | 76 (53.1%) | 67 (46.9%) |
Professional & Scientific | 22 (51.2%) | 21 (48.8%) |
Enterprise Management |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Administrative & Support | 0 (0.0%) | 3 (100.0%) |
Educational Services | 75 (38.5%) | 120 (61.5%) |
Health Care & Social Assistance | 38 (7.5%) | 471 (92.5%) |
Arts, Entertainment & Recreation |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Accommodation & Food Services | 16 (12.3%) | 114 (87.7%) |
Public Administration | 65 (74.7%) | 22 (25.3%) |
Total | 1,087 (48.5%) | 1,155 (51.5%) |
